Transaction 503e58598ece13c70cb3d18220427a036640486921861037c96d4bcdc819b606

1 Input
3 Outputs
  • 503e58598ece13c70cb3d18220427a036640486921861037c96d4bcdc819b606:0
  • value  3453078
    address  1FoWyxwPXuj4C6abqwhjDWdz6D4PZgYRjA
  • 503e58598ece13c70cb3d18220427a036640486921861037c96d4bcdc819b606:1
  • value  0
    address  
  • 503e58598ece13c70cb3d18220427a036640486921861037c96d4bcdc819b606:2
  • value  540
    address  3NrZBJk7LQbDVTDBN9zerZWro3oVxhjEfS